Maisie Peters is a talented singer-songwriter from Sussex who has been performing since she was a teenager. Known for her wavy blonde bob and unique style, Maisie has always stood out, whether she’s wearing a high-neck jumper or sparkling socks. In August 2024, she opened for Taylor Swift, and her socks had 'MP3' on them, which fans guessed was a hint about her next album. Now, almost two years later, Maisie’s new album 'Florescence' has finally been released, and she says it’s been a long time coming. Maisie is excited for her fans to hear the new songs and hopes they become a part of their lives, not just hers.
Maisie’s music career has been impressive. She’s supported big names like Coldplay and Ed Sheeran, and she signed to Ed Sheeran’s label when she was just 21. Her last album, 'The Good Witch', came out in June 2023 and went straight to number one in the UK. That album was all about the ups and downs of love and heartbreak in her early twenties, and her fans loved it. Now, at 25, Maisie says 'Florescence' is the next step in her journey. She feels more healed and grown up, and she thinks her new music shows how much she’s changed as a person and as an artist.
Maisie wants her fans to know that 'Florescence' will sound different from her earlier work. She says the album has a new tone and style, but it still tells the same kinds of stories, just from a different point of view. For example, her older song 'History of Man' was about heartbreak, but the new album ends with a calm and peaceful song called 'Nothing Like Being In Love'. Maisie admits that making this album wasn’t always easy. She’s had to deal with insecurities, anxiety, and even some vocal problems. She remembers getting upset during a soundcheck when she was supporting Noah Kahan in 2024. But things have improved, and Maisie has found inspiration by working with other artists. She collaborated with Julia Michaels, who wrote the song 'Kingmaker', and Marcus Mumford from Mumford & Sons, who sings on 'If You Let Me'. Maisie also worked with Amelia Dimoldenberg, who directed the trailer for the album and the video for 'My Regards'. The video was inspired by the British teen film 'Angus, Thongs and Perfect Snogging', and fans loved seeing the main actress Georgia Groome in it. Maisie says filming the video was a wild experience, especially when she had to walk around in a giant daisy costume in the rain. Maisie is planning a big show at the O2 in London next year, and she’s a bit nervous but hopes her fans will come. She’s excited for everyone to hear 'Florescence', which is out now.
